The Los Angeles Rams progressed into the next step of training camp Monday when they held their first padded practice at Loyola Marymount. Matthew Stafford got the day off, his first and only of camp, but Jimmy Garoppolo and Stetson Bennett stepped up in his place and led the offense.
Overall, it was a better day from the defense, with Sean McVay sharing praise for the players on that side of the ball.
